What are Automatic Vacuum Cleaners and Mops?
Automatic vacuum, often referred to as robotic vacuums, are devices created to clean floors autonomously. Equipped with innovative sensing units and navigation systems, they can draw up a space, recognize challenges, and clean effectively without human intervention. Likewise, automatic mops, or robotic mops, are developed to sweep and mop floorings, utilizing various innovations to guarantee a comprehensive cleaning experience.
Secret Features of Automatic Vacuum Cleaners and Mops
Advanced Navigation Systems
Laser Mapping: Some designs use L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) innovation to create detailed maps of the home, allowing them to browse with precision.Camera-Based Navigation: These gadgets utilize electronic cameras to determine challenges and map the environment, ensuring that they do not run into furniture or get stuck.** Cliff Detection Sensors : Prevent the device from falling down stairs or other drop-offs.
Versatile Cleaning Modes
Area Cleaning: Focuses on cleaning a specific location, ideal for spills or high-traffic areas.Edge Cleaning: Designed to clean along the edges and corners of spaces where dirt and dust typically build up.Scheduled Cleaning: Allows users to set cleaning schedules, making sure that the home is always clean without manual effort.
Dust Collection and Mopping Capabilities
HEPA Filters: Capture even the tiniest particles, making them appropriate for homes with animals or allergic reactions. interchangeable Cleaning Heads **: Can change between vacuuming and mopping, supplying a detailed cleaning solution.Water Flow Control: Regulates the quantity of water used during mopping to prevent damage to floors.
User-Friendly Controls
Smart device Apps: Most designs include buddy apps that permit users to manage the device, set cleaning schedules, and monitor cleaning progress.Voice Assistants: Integration with voice assistants like Amazon Alexa or Google Assistant for hands-free operation.Remote Controls: Some models still provide traditional remote controls for those who prefer physical buttons.
Energy Efficiency and Maintenance
Battery Life: Modern automatic cleaners and mops have extended battery life, allowing them to clean larger locations in a single charge.Self-Charging: They can go back to their charging dock automatically when the battery is low.Low Maintenance: Many designs come with self-cleaning brushes and filters, decreasing the need for frequent manual cleaning.Benefits of Using Automatic Vacuum Cleaners and Mops

Q1: Are automatic vacuum and mops ideal for pet owners?
A1: Yes, lots of designs are developed with pet owners in mind. They feature HEPA filters to catch pet hair and dander, and some have specialized brushes to handle pet hair more successfully.
Q2: Can these devices clean all floor types?
A2: Most models are versatile and can manage wood, tile, and low-pile carpets. However, plush carpets and extremely irregular surfaces might present difficulties. It's important to check the producer's specs to guarantee the gadget appropriates for your floor type.
Q3: How frequently should I clean up the filters and brushes?
A3: It's advised to clean up the filters and brushes every few weeks, depending on use. For homes with pets or high traffic, more frequent cleaning might be necessary.
Q4: Can I control the gadget while it's cleaning?
A4: Yes, lots of designs can be managed via a smart device app or voice assistant. This allows you to start, stop, or pause the cleaning process as required.
Q5: What should I do if the gadget gets stuck?
A5: If the device gets stuck, it will normally send out an alert to your smartphone or sound an alert. You can then manually move it to a clear area. To prevent this, guarantee the room is devoid of small items and cable televisions.
Q6: Are automatic vacuum cleaners and mops energy-efficient?
A6: Yes, modern-day styles are significantly energy-efficient. They use advanced algorithms to optimize battery usage and return to their charging docks immediately when the battery is low.
Q7: Can I set particular locations for the gadget to prevent?
A7: Yes, most models include virtual walls or no-go zones that can be set via the app or physical gadgets. This enables you to keep particular locations, like pet food bowls or children's backyard, devoid of cleaning.
